Description

The use of UV light in modern dentistry has been covered in a number of articles and literature since 2010. The micromotor can be used on patients in various clinical situations, such as when removing composites, removing decay, and finishing/polishing restorative composites. It operates on the following principle: the spectrum of ultraviolet light energizes the fluorescent components of certain resins, turning the composite a different colour to the dentin, thus making the professional’s job easier. Another interesting feature of this light beam is its ability to identify the presence of decay inside the tooth.
